Leveraging technology: LED screens, audio visual, and hybrid event integration
The integration of advanced technology is transforming the conference stage setup into a multi-sensory experience. LED screens are now a staple in both physical and virtual event environments, providing high-resolution visuals for presentations, live feeds, and interactive content. The versatility of LED screens allows for creative stage backdrops and dynamic set designs that adapt to the flow of the event.
Audio visual (AV) systems are essential for delivering clear sound and impactful visuals to both in-person and remote audiences. AV technicians work closely with event planners to ensure seamless integration of microphones, speakers, and projection equipment. The conference setup often includes multiple screens and audio zones to accommodate large audiences and breakout sessions.
Hybrid events demand robust technology infrastructure to bridge the gap between physical and virtual participants. Real-time networking apps, interactive Q&A sessions, and immersive virtual environments are now standard features of corporate event production. As one expert explains, "Hybrid events in 2026 feature fully integrated in-person and digital formats with real-time networking apps, interactive Q&A, and immersive virtual environments."

Audience-centric layouts and panel configurations for impactful events
Designing the layout of a conference room requires careful consideration of audience flow, sightlines, and engagement opportunities. The stage setup must facilitate clear communication between speakers, panelists, and attendees, whether the event is in-person, hybrid, or fully virtual. Modular stage sets allow for quick reconfiguration, supporting a variety of panel discussions, workshops, and networking sessions.
Panel configurations are tailored to the objectives of each session, with stage design elements such as tiered seating, curved backdrops, and integrated LED screens enhancing visibility and interaction. The use of red carpet entrances and branded stage backdrops adds a touch of elegance and reinforces the corporate identity of the event.
Professional event production teams leverage audience analytics to optimize the layout and maximize engagement. The placement of screens, lighting, and audio zones is strategically planned to ensure every attendee has an immersive experience. Sustainable practices and eco-friendly stage production in corporate events
Sustainability has become a defining feature of modern corporate event production, influencing every aspect of stage setup and set design. Event planners and sustainability consultants collaborate to minimize environmental impact through the use of recyclable materials, energy-efficient lighting, and modular stage components. This commitment to green practices aligns with the values of both organizers and attendees.
Eco-friendly stage backdrops and biophilic design elements are increasingly popular, creating a sense of connection with nature while reducing the carbon footprint of the event. The adoption of LED lighting and projection mapping further enhances energy efficiency, supporting the transition to more sustainable corporate events. As one expert states, "Sustainability is crucial as it minimizes environmental impact, aligns with corporate social responsibility goals, and meets the growing demand for eco-friendly practices among attendees."
Corporate events are also embracing digital solutions to reduce waste, such as virtual event platforms and paperless registration systems. The integration of these technologies into the conference stage setup not only streamlines operations but also demonstrates a commitment to responsible event management.
